Hiking around Chauvirey-Le-Vieil offers diverse terrain within the Haute-Saône department of eastern France. The region features a tranquil rural setting with rolling countryside, dense forests, and meandering waterways like the Galley stream and Ougeotte River. Elevations range from 242 meters to 341 meters, providing varied topography with gentle ascents and descents. The area is characterized by a significant wooded context and proximity to natural features such as the Plateau des 1000 Étangs.

The terrain around Chauvirey-le-Vieil is quite varied, characterized by rolling countryside, dense forests, and meandering waterways. You'll find paths with gentle ascents and descents, as the elevation in the area ranges from 242 to 341 meters. The region's Celtic name, 'Chauvirey,' meaning 'mountain, town, and water,' aptly describes its hilly and aquatic features.

The region is rich in natural beauty and historical interest. You might encounter the meandering Galley stream, which flows at the foot of Chauvirey-le-Vieil. Further afield, the unique Plateau des 1000 Étangs offers a stunning landscape of picturesque ponds. Locally, you can explore highlights such as the Small path on the banks of the Moulin stream or the Tree house.
Yes, the area around Chauvirey-le-Vieil is dotted with historical elements. Hikers can discover local heritage such as an 18th-century reconstructed church, fountains, washhouses, and remnants of a prehistoric station and a Gallo-Roman villa. You can also find the Ruins of Cherlieu Abbey and the Chateau la Rochelle nearby.
The region's diverse landscapes, from dry grasslands with wild orchids to lush riverine environments, make it appealing across seasons. Spring and early summer are ideal for enjoying the blooming flora, while autumn offers beautiful foliage in the dense forests. The mild climate of eastern France generally allows for pleasant hiking from spring through early autumn.
